Output 16a735666870c89c67a920ccc76f66013a5ebe1abd82003bcd18ce08505badd9:0

value
6975096314036
script pubkey
OP_0 OP_PUSHBYTES_20 f8b1be37442a1b076f136e01ac4701be42524e8f
address
tb1qlzcmud6y9gdswmcndcq6c3cphep9yn50zzwev0
transaction
16a735666870c89c67a920ccc76f66013a5ebe1abd82003bcd18ce08505badd9
confirmations
187564
spent
true